Moldova entry requirements for Bahrain passport holders
Bahraini passport holders need an eVisa to enter Moldova in 2026. The application is done entirely online before you travel, and approval usually takes a few business days. Once approved, you can stay for up to 90 days within a 180-day period.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| eVisa application Apply before travel | You need an eVisa to enter Moldova. Apply at the official Moldova eVisa portal at least 10 business days before your trip. The eVisa is single-entry and costs €80 — pay online with a credit card.Apply for eVisa | Required |
| Valid passport Must cover your entire stay | Your passport must be valid for the full duration of your stay in Moldova. Moldova does not enforce a 6-month validity rule — just make sure it doesn't expire before you leave.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Proof of departure | Border officers routinely ask for a return or onward ticket showing you leave Moldova within the eVisa's validity period. Have a printed or digital copy ready. | Required |
| Proof of accommodation Hotel booking or invitation letter | Immigration may ask where you're staying. Carry a hotel confirmation, rental agreement, or a notarized invitation from a Moldovan host. A booking on your phone works.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Show you can support yourself | Officers can request evidence of sufficient funds — roughly €50 per day of stay. A recent bank statement or cash in euros/lei is fine. | Recommended |

Transiting through Moldova
Bahrain passport holders transiting through Moldova do not need a transit visa if they remain airside and have a confirmed onward ticket within 24 hours.
- Holders of valid Schengen, US, UK, or Canada visas may transit without visa for up to 5 days under certain conditions.
